Okay so I'm going to be judging in a few different categories, out of 5 including food, variety, atmosphere, service, and decor.
1) Food: 4/5
I rate the food a 4/5 because, I ordered the chicken fingers with fries (I know at Texas place that's a little odd), and I thought they were great. The chicken was cooked well and had a thick crispy breading, and the fries were crispy, delicious, and golden. But the place they lost a point is that my mom ordered the fajitas, which is their signature dish, and I loved the plating and style, but i didn't think the fajitas were so fabulous that they should be considered their signature dish.
2) Menu Variety: 4/5
I rate the menu variety 4/5 because I feel that it had a wide variety of different Texas inspired dishes which make it easy for the average person to find a delicious Texas meal to enjoy. The place where it lost points is that, I feel that from my experience the kids menu could have a little more variety since a lot of kids are picky eaters, so they could have a little more menu variety to honour that.
3) Atmosphere: 4.5/5
I rate the atmosphere 4.5/5 because I feel that it had a great, fun, rodeo style atmosphere. The wood and plaid style tables and walls added to that atmosphere along with the cowgirl and cowboy dressed servers. Overall it felt like a fun good time. The place where it looses the extra half point is that i felt that it was lacking the slightest bit of fanciness that you expect from a restaurant. I mean even though it isn't supposed to be fancy restaurant it lacked that slight fanciness.
4) Service: 3.75/5
I rate the service 3.75/5 because the food was not exactly lickety split. We went at an odd time of about 3 in the afternoon, where there were only a few tables occupied so I would've expected a little bit faster service. It gained points because our server was nice and was able to answer any questions we had. The only other place they lost points is that, when the servers weren't serving us I felt they were a little unprofessional.
5) Decor: 5/5
I rate the decor 5/5 because I absolutely love the decor. I think it was very fitting for the style of restaurant. I loved the DIY, Texas feel that it had to it. The decor just made the dinner. It gave it a something that separates it from other restaurant, and I thought it was great.
I think that Lone Star is a fabulous restaurant for a party environment, or a family meal. Overall I think that it is a good restaurant that people can enjoy for all types of reasons.
